Liste des terroristes du vol American Airlines 77 établie par le FBI

1) Khalid Almihdhar - Possible Saudi national

 Possible resident of San Diego, California, and New York
 Alias : Sannan Al-Makki ; Khalid Bin Muhammad ; ’Addallah Al-Mihdhar ; Khalid Mohammad Al-Saqaf

2) Majed Moqed - Possible Saudi national

 Alias : Majed M.GH Moqed ; Majed Moqed, Majed Mashaan Moqed

3) Nawaf Alhazmi - Possible Saudi national

 Possible resident of Fort Lee, New Jersey ; Wayne, New Jersey ; San Diego, California
 Alias : Nawaf Al-Hazmi ; Nawaf Al Hazmi ; Nawaf M.S. Al Hazmi

4) Salem Alhazmi - Possible Saudi national

 Possible resident of Fort Lee, New Jersey ; Wayne, New Jersey

5) Hani Hanjour

 Possible resident of Phoenix, Arizona, and San Diego, California
 Alias : Hani Saleh Hanjour ; Hani Saleh ; Hani Hanjour, Hani Saleh H. Hanjour

(Document original du FBI)
